I whole heartedly agree with the principle, but in reality, this would never fly. IMO, two questions I want to ask for every potential law are…Is it enforceable?…and…What are the unintended consequences?
I don’t see this as enforceable. Not at a realistic cost anyway. Assuming the contraception is not permanent, how would you ensure that the contraception is used. Could it be some sort of monthly shot every time you go to pick up your welfare check? What about those who are religiously against contraception? What would the punishment be if someone gets pregnant while on welfare? Forced abortion, forced adoption? Permanent contraception? Prison time? A monetary fine? It’s a mess anyway you do it.
The unintended consequences are worse. You’re basically saying the government has the right to determine who can and cannot have children based on income. So we’ll draw a line somewhere around the poverty level, at first, but then there will be studies that will prompt the government to raise the amount. What else will the government start controlling? Plus there will be women who chose to not get welfare, then we will hear about the growing homeless problem and the people we aren’t taking care of. And yes, I understand there is a difference between dictating our lives and denying benefits if conditions aren’t met. However, I don’t think the media and general public will make that distinction.
The way I see it, this country made a decision a long time ago…no one will be allowed to fail at life. The government will support everyone, regardless of their bad decisions, and how much they deserve to fail. We don’t have the stomach for it, particularly if kids are involved. And like anything else, the failures will get worse and worse and more and more people will fall, because we do not allow rock bottom…for women anyway. That isn’t going to change until we have a drastic shift in attitude about those that are not pulling their own weight. And that attitude is actually shifting in the opposite direction these days. I honestly think we will never let people fall, until the western world starts caving in on itself, or we reach a level of technology where work is really no longer required.
